Short yoga routines not only improve flexibility and strength but also promote an overall sense of calmness. Engaging in just ten minutes of yoga can alleviate anxiety and help in emotional regulation. Consider beginning with simple stretches such as Cat-Cow and Downward Dog, as they warm up the spine and increase blood circulation. Engage your core and back muscles during these poses to create stability, which is essential during busier moments. Creating a designated space for these quick sessions can enhance the effectiveness and make it easier to commit to daily practices. Taking deep breaths while transitioning between poses is crucial. When practicing short yoga routines, it’s essential to focus on the quality of your movements rather than achieving complicated asanas. Modifying poses is perfectly acceptable to suit your current level. Pay attention to your body and its limits—avoid straining or pushing too hard. Embracing a beginner’s mindset will help cultivate a welcoming environment for self-discovery and growth. Engage in simple yet effective poses, such as standing forward bend or seated spinal twists. These can stretch the body and stimulate the digestive system, while also relieving tension. Concentrate on body awareness, recognizing areas that hold stress and working to release it. Integrate mindfulness practices like closing your eyes during poses to deepen your focus. This meditative approach helps reconnect with your breath. The Benefits of Short Yoga Routines

Short yoga routines offer numerous benefits, particularly for those leading busy lifestyles. Engaging in these invigorating sessions enhances physical strength while simultaneously easing mental burdens. Stress relief is among the most significant advantages of yoga, releasing endorphins that help elevate mood. Regular practice can even improve sleep quality and overall emotional well-being. Finding time for yoga breaks throughout your day enables you to cultivate mindfulness and focus on the present moment, thus enhancing productivity. In addition, these sessions promote improved posture and flexibility, essential factors for preventing injuries. Incorporating yoga into your day creates a sense of calm amidst chaos. You’ll find that managing daily responsibilities can feel lighter and more fulfilling. Furthermore, focusing on breath control during short routines can aid in coping with heightened stress levels. Research suggests that even brief sessions of yoga can foster increases in self-awareness and acceptance. This can lead to strengthened relationships with family, friends, and colleagues.
